Primary CNS lymphoma symptoms vary depending on the location of the tumor, but they generally develop over weeks or months. The most common primary CNS lymphoma symptoms include focal neurological deficits, asymmetric weakness, impaired movement, and neurocognitive impairments. Some patients may also experience changes in personality. In addition to neurological impairments, these patients may also experience urinary incontinence, bowel dysfunction, and visual disturbances.
